Electronic forms (eforms) allow total e-forms automation that is uniquely enhanced with real looking on-screen forms that print exactly like the original (if it ever even existed). - Unlike page document composition, EZ-Forms' logical object oriented drawing tools are specifically tailored and optimized for forms design and manipulation.

Its WYSIWYG (what-you-see-is-what-you-get) interactive screen is clear, intuitive and easy to use. Font size, typeface and printer options (including FAX transmission) are limited only by what is available under Microsoft Windows.
